Verdun is a multiplayer first person shooter set during World War I (Concept) that aims to convey the intensity of trench warfare. The maps are based on historical locations around the city of Verdun in north-eastern France. The game was released on Steam April 28th, 2015 for PC (Platform), Mac (Platform) and Linux (Platform).
The game features multiplayer gameplay only.
Frontlines is an objective based game mode fully geared towards the WW1 theme. Every map has 3 or 4 trench lines for each side with nomansland in between every two trench lines. Every side will take turns in attacking and defending. If a attack succeeds the battles continues from there, making this a tug of war which only ends if all trench lines are captured by one side or until the level timer ends.
RDM is a FFA game mode where only rifles are used. The maps are smaller as is the maximum player count per match.
